Abstract
Blends of polyamide fibres with wool, viscose rayon and cellulose triacetate have been examined by differential thermal analysis with a DuPont 920 Thermograph. A procedure is presented which is well suited for the characterisation of fibre blends containing polyamide. Those features of the D.T.A. curves best suited for use in qualitative and quantitative analysis are discussed.
